Regular engagement in the community supports emotional well-being, social inclusion, and personal growth. Participants often report better motivation and confidence when they are actively involved in activities they enjoy. Families also gain peace of mind when they see reliable progress and positive routines being built.
When community access support is personalised and consistent, participants can develop practical life skills in natural environments rather than only in structured sessions.
